Careful-Use Notes
While the designs are charming, they include some dense stitch areas and tiny details that may require extra care during embroidery. Small lettering, if present, should be checked for legibility. Thick fabrics or curved surfaces like caps may affect the final appearance, so testing on scrap fabric is essential. Dark fabrics can also impact thread color contrast, so choosing the right thread colors is key.
For commercial embroidery, ensure the embroidery file is compatible with your machine and that the hoop size allows for accurate stitching. A proper stabilizer will help maintain the design’s integrity, especially on stretchy or textured materials.

Embroidery Designer Notes
Before finalizing your craft fair product line, test the Mylar Sweet Easter Bunnies design on scrap fabric to assess how it translates on different materials. Check thread colors against the fabric to ensure visibility and contrast. Review spacing and stitch density to avoid overcrowding or distortion.
Confirm the hoop size required for each design and use the appropriate stabilizer for your chosen fabric. Create at least one real mockup to see how the design looks in person. Compare fabric colors to ensure the bunnies stand out, and always verify commercial licensing terms before selling finished products.
